Output e5640da76beb561ccfc915210a53d84095fbb07b848ef6370a87759b765161a8:0

value
214865
script pubkey
OP_0 OP_PUSHBYTES_20 5ae1f150a88312d7d4fabab57931ecfdd504edb6
address
bc1qttslz59gsvfd0486h26hjv0vlh2sfmdk2yvgln
transaction
e5640da76beb561ccfc915210a53d84095fbb07b848ef6370a87759b765161a8
spent
true